Miley Cyrus' upcoming album is called Endless Summer Vacation, which is slated to be out sometime in Q1. The announcement of the lead single, which is called "Flowers", will be on New Year's Eve at midnight ET and it's going to be released on January 13.

Sales breakdown in UK for the album (from the Sales thread).
18,746 Miley Cyrus - Endless Summer Vacation [4,969 CDs, 3,150 vinyl, 2,385 downloads, 8,242 streaming]
